Crews Begin Construction On Glenwood Station
The mixed-use building will feature luxury residences, a fitness center, a clubhouse and 1,500 square feet of commercial space.
GLEN ELLYN, IL — Crews have begun construction on Glenwood Station, a mixed-used development project that will feature luxury residences, a 24-hour fitness center, a clubhouse and commercial space.
The five-story building will be located at the former site of the McChesney and Miller Grocery Store, now 464 Glenwood Ave.
Plans for Glenwood Station were first presented to the Glen Ellyn Village Council in spring of 2020 by Holladay Properties and was approved later that year.

The development will consist of studio, one- and two-bedroom units. Residents will have access to an outdoor fire pit area with grills, in addition to heated parking with stations for charging electric vehicles.
McChesney and Miller Grocery Store shuttered in 2014 after decades in the village. Glenwood Station's developers are planning to integrate the store's sign into the new building's design, in a further effort to integrate classic characteristics of the village's historic style.

It's anticipated that construction Glenwood Station will wrap up in 2025.
